A.P. Bio Season 3 Trailer Reveals the Comedy's Peacock Debut

Peacock has revealed the full trailer forA.P. Bioseason 3, the first season of the NBC comedy to debut on the brand new streaming service. Created byMike O’Brien, the series starsIt’s Always Sunny in PhiladelphiaalumGlenn Howertonas a disgraced Harvard philosophy professor forced to return to his hometown of Toledo and teach at a local high school. A.P. Bio also starsPatton Oswalt,Aparna Brielle,Mary Sohn,Lyric Lewis,Jean Villepique,Jacob McCarthy,Paula Pell, andTom Bennett. Al Pacino’s First Lead Role Was a Precursor to ‘The Godfather’ & ‘Scarface'

Jerry Schatzberg’sThe Panic In Needle Parkis a 1971 drama film co-written byJoan DidionandJohn Gregory Dunne, based on the 1966 novel of the same name byJames Mills.What the film is arguably most remembered for is beingAl Pacino’s first starring roleas Bobby, a small-time hustler and addict. The film is a gritty and harrowing tale of love and addiction in New York City, following the relationship of Bobby and his addict-to-be lover Helen (Kitty Winn), who falls deep into the NYC heroin scene, tarnishing their relationship and leading to a series of heart-breaking betrayals....

All 4 'Men in Black' Movies, Ranked

In 1997, superstarWill Smith(Independence Day) joined forces with Academy Award winnerTommy Lee Jones(The Fugitive) to star in the sci-fi comedyMen in Black. Based on the eponymous comic book series, the film follows two agents working for a secret organization investigating and monitoring aliens secretly living on Earth. The film was a major box office hit, so logically, it spawned two sequels and a multimedia franchise. However, its sequels were more divisive with both critics and audiences....

Awkwafina Joins Dwayne Johnson, Kevin Hart in Jumanji Sequel

Rapper-turned-actressAwkwafinais coming off one hell of a year betweenCrazy Rich AsiansandOcean’s 8and it didn’t go unnoticed by Hollywood, as Sony has signed up the red-hot star for itsJumanjisequel, Collider has confirmed. Awkwafina, whose real name isNora Lum, will joinDwayne Johnson,Kevin Hart,Jack BlackandKaren Gillanin the film, which remains untitled and is still slated for release in December. That month proved lucky for Sony in 2017, whenJumanji: Welcome to the Junglegrossed an eye-opening $962 million worldwide....
